16GB DDR4 3200MHz CL22 memory module designed for Lenovo ThinkCentre Neo 50s and 50t desktops
This 16 GB DDR4 module is built for Lenovo ThinkCentre Neo 50s and Neo 50t desktops. It adds capacity to small-form-factor and tower systems that use standard 288-pin unbuffered memory. Buyers with other Lenovo models or custom builds should verify compatibility before ordering.
The stick runs at 3200 MHz with CL22 timing at 1.2 V and is backward compatible with 2133, 2400, 2666 and 2933 MHz systems. If your board requires a different voltage, ECC support or a lower CAS latency this module will not meet that requirement.
Open the case, align the notch with the DDR4 slot and press until the latches click. No heat spreader means low-profile clearance is not an issue. The most common mistake is seating the module unevenly so the latches do not engage fully.
